音声認識ベースの Web を作成しようとしています。いくつか検索した結果、cmusphinx は音声認識アプリケーションに非常に適したライブラリであることがわかりました。そして私の問題は、cmusphinx と web の間でどのように通信できるかです。これがばかげた質問である場合は申し訳ありません。
ご助力いただきありがとうございます !
音声認識ベースの Web を作成しようとしています。いくつか検索した結果、cmusphinx は音声認識アプリケーションに非常に適したライブラリであることがわかりました。そして私の問題は、cmusphinx と web の間でどのように通信できるかです。これがばかげた質問である場合は申し訳ありません。
ご助力いただきありがとうございます !
一般に、JavaまたはCコードにWebリクエストをマーシャリングするためのWebフレームワークが必要です。次に、CMUSphinxAPIを使用して必要な音声テキスト変換メソッドを実装する必要があります。
JAX-RSチュートリアルは次のとおりです。
http://docs.oracle.com/javaee/6/tutorial/doc/giepu.html
Ruby用のSinatraなど、より軽量なWebサービスフレームワークもあります。
たとえば、CMUSphinxを使用してWebサービスの既存の実装を調査することもできます。
https://github.com/alumae/ruby-pocketsphinx-server
詳しくはこちらをご覧ください。